Linux常用命令收集

SSH 远程传文件/文件夹

1、上传本地文件到服务器

# 本地/home目录下的root.jar文件上传到服务器192.168.0.101上的/var/www目录下
scp /home/root.jar root@192.168.0.101:/var/www/

2、上传本地文件夹到服务器

# 本地/home/java目录上传到服务器192.168.0.101上的/var/www目录下
scp -r /home/java root@192.168.0.101:/var/www/

3、从服务器下载文件到本地

# 从服务器192.168.0.101上下载/var/www目录下的test.txt到本地/home目录下
scp root@192.168.0.101:/var/www/test.txt /home

4、从服务器下载目录到本地

# 从服务器192.168.0.101上下载/var/www/java目录到本地的/home/java下
scp -r root@192.168.0.101:/var/www/java  /home/java

压缩解压

1、tar命令

# 压缩
tar -cvf a.tar /home/software/*
#解压tar
tar -xvf a.tar 
#解压tar.gz
tar -zxvf a.tar.gz

2、zip/unzip命令

# 压缩zip,将mysql文件夹压缩为mysql.zip
zip -r mysql.zip mysql
# 解压unzip
unzip mysql.zip
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值